Operational CheckNJS000GK
The purpose of the operational check is to check if the individual system operates properly.
CHECKING MEMORY FUNCTION
1. Press the temperature control (UP) switch (driver side) until 32C (90F) is displayed.
2. Press OFF switch.
3. Turn ignition switch OFF.
4. Turn ignition switch ON.
5. Press the AUTO switch.
6. Confirm that the set temperature remains at previous temperature.
7. Press OFF switch.
If NG, go to trouble diagnosis procedure for ATC-112, "
Memory Function" .
If OK, continue the check.
CHECKING BLOWER
1. Press fan (UP:+) switch. Blower should operate on low speed. The fan symbol should have one blade lit.
2. Press fan (UP:+) switch again, and continue checking blower speed and fan symbol until all speeds are
checked.
3. Leave blower on max. speed.
If NG, go to trouble diagnosis procedure for ATC-89, "
Blower Motor Circuit" .
If OK, continue the check.
CHECKING DISCHARGE AIR (MODE SWITCH AND DEF SWITCH)
1. Press MODE switch and DEF switch.
2. Each position indicator should change shape.
3. Confirm that discharge air comes out according to the air distribution table. Refer to AT C - 3 7 , "
Discharge
Air Flow" .
If NG, go to trouble diagnosis procedure for ATC-75, "
Mode Door Motor Circuit" .
If OK, continue the check.
NOTE:
Confirm that the compressor clutch is engaged (sound or visual inspection) and intake door position is at
FRESH when the D/F or DEF is selected.Conditions : Engine running at normal operating temperature

Rear Control Switch CircuitNJS000GM
DIAGNOSIS PROCEDURE FOR REAR CONTROL SWITCH
SYMPTOM: Rear control switch does not operate.
1. CHECK A/C SYSTEM
Check multifunction switch, confirm A/C system operation.
OK or NG
OK >> GO TO 2.
NG >> Go to trouble diagnosis procedure for A/C system. Refer to AT C - 6 6 , "
Power Supply and Ground
Circuit for Auto Amp." .
2. CHECK REAR CONTROL SWITCH
Check rear control switch, except for A/C switch (audio) operation.
OK or NG
OK >> GO TO 5.
NG >> GO TO 3.
3. CHECK POWER SUPPLY FOR REAR CONTROL SWITCH
1. Turn ignition switch OFF.
2. Disconnect rear control switch connector.
3. Turn ignition switch ACC.
4. Check voltage between rear control switch harness connector
B554 terminal 1 and ground.
OK or NG
OK >> GO TO 4.
NG >> Check 10A fuse [No. 6 located in the fuse block (J/B)].
Refer to P G - 111 , "
FUSE BLOCK - JUNCTION BOX (J/
B)" .
If fuse is OK, check harness for open circuit. Repair or replace if necessary.
If fuse is NG, check harness for short circuit and replace fuse.
4. CHECK GROUND CIRCUIT FOR REAR CONTROL SWITCH
1. Turn ignition switch OFF.
2. Check continuity between rear control switch harness connector
B554 terminal 4 and ground.
OK or NG
OK >> GO TO 5.
NG >> Repair harness or connector.
5. CHECK REAR CONTROL SWITCH, AV CONTROL UNIT OR NAVI CONTROL UNIT
Check circuit between rear control switch and AV control unit or NAVI control unit AV- 1 0 8 , "
TROUBLE DIAG-
NOSIS" (Without mobile entertainment system) or AV- 2 5 3 , "TROUBLE DIAGNOSIS" (With mobile entertain-
ment system).
OK or NG
OK >> Replace rear control switch.
NG >> Replace part or repair for result trouble diagnosis.1 – Ground : Battery voltage

LAN System CircuitNJS000GN
SYMPTOM: Mode door motors, upper ventilator door motor, air mix door motors and intake door motor does
not operate normally.
DIAGNOSIS PROCEDURE FOR LAN CIRCUIT
1. CHECK POWER SUPPLY FOR UNIFIED METER AND A/C AMP.
1. Turn ignition switch ON.
2. Check voltage between unified meter and A/C amp. harness
connector M65 terminal 70 and ground.
OK or NG
OK >> GO TO 2.
NG >> Replace unified meter and A/C amp.
2. CHECK SIGNAL FOR UNIFIED METER AND A/C AMP.
Confirm A/C LAN signal between unified meter and A/C amp. har-
ness connector M65 terminal 69 and ground using an oscilloscope.
OK or NG
OK >> GO TO 3.
NG >> Replace unified meter and A/C amp.

6. CHECK MOTOR OPERATION
1. Reconnect each door motor connector.
2. Turn ignition switch ON.
3. Confirm operation of each door motor.
OK or NG
OK >> (Return to operate normally.)
Poor contact in motor connector.
NG >> (Does not operate normally.)
GO TO 7.
7. CHECK UPPER VENTILATOR DOOR MOTOR, AIR MIX DOOR MOTOR AND INTAKE DOOR MOTOR
OPERATION
1. Turn ignition switch OFF.
2. Disconnect mode (driver side, passenger side), upper ventilator, air mix (driver side, passenger side), and
intake door motor connectors.
3. Reconnect upper ventilator, air mix (driver side, passenger side) and intake door motor connectors.
4. Turn ignition switch ON.
5. Confirm operation of upper ventilator, air mix door motor (driver side, passenger side) and intake door
motor.
OK or NG
OK >> [Upper ventilator, air mix (driver side, passenger side) and intake door motors operate normally.]
GO TO 11.
NG >> [Upper ventilator, air mix (driver side, passenger side) and intake door motors does not operate
normally.]
GO TO 8.
8. CHECK MODE DOOR MOTOR, AIR MIX DOOR MOTOR AND INTAKE DOOR MOTOR OPERATION
1. Turn ignition switch OFF.
2. Disconnect upper ventilator door motor connector.
3. Reconnect mode door motor (driver side, passenger side) connectors.
4. Turn ignition switch ON.
5. Confirm operation of mode door motor (driver side, passenger side), air mix door motor (driver side, pas-
senger side) and intake door motor.
OK or NG
OK >> [Mode (driver side, passenger side), air mix (driver side, passenger side) and intake door motors
operate normally.]
Replace upper ventilator door motor.
NG >> [Mode (driver side, passenger side), air mix (driver side, passenger side) and intake door motors
does not operate normally.]
GO TO 9.

9. CHECK MODE DOOR MOTOR, UPPER VENTILATOR DOOR MOTOR AND INTAKE DOOR MOTOR
OPERATION
1. Turn ignition switch OFF.
2. Disconnect air mix door motor (driver side, passenger side) connectors.
3. Reconnect upper ventilator door motor connector.
4. Turn ignition switch ON.
5. Confirm operation of mode door motor (driver side, passenger side), upper ventilator door motor and
intake door motor.
OK or NG
OK >> [Mode (driver side, passenger side), upper ventilator and intake door motors operate normally.]
GO TO 12.
NG >> [Mode (driver side, passenger side), upper ventilator and intake door motors does not operate
normally.]
GO TO 10.
10. CHECK MODE DOOR MOTOR, UPPER VENTILATOR DOOR MOTOR AND AIR MIX DOOR MOTOR
OPERATION
1. Turn ignition switch OFF.
2. Disconnect intake door motor connector.
3. Reconnect air mix door motor (driver side, passenger side) connectors.
4. Turn ignition switch ON.
5. Confirm operation of mode door motor (driver side, passenger side), upper ventilator door motor and air
mix door motor (driver side, passenger side).
OK or NG
OK >> [Mode (driver side, passenger side), upper ventilator and air mix door motor (driver side, passen-
ger side) operate normally.]
Replace intake door motor.
NG >> [Mode (driver side, passenger side), upper ventilator and air mix door motor (driver side, passen-
ger side) does not operate normally.]
Replace unified meter and A/C amp.
11 . CHECK MODE DOOR MOTOR OPERATION
1. Turn ignition switch OFF.
2. Reconnect mode door motor (passenger side) connector.
3. Turn ignition switch ON.
4. Confirm operation of mode door motor (passenger side).
OK or NG
OK >> [Mode door motor (passenger side) operates normally.]
Replace mode door motor (driver side).
NG >> [Mode door motor (passenger side) does not operate normally.]
Replace mode door motor (passenger side).

12. CHECK AIR MIX DOOR MOTOR OPERATION
1. Turn ignition switch OFF.
2. Reconnect air mix door motor (passenger side) connector.
3. Turn ignition switch ON.
4. Confirm operation of air mix door motor (passenger side).
OK or NG
OK >> [Air mix door motor (passenger side) operates normally.]
Replace air mix door motor (driver side).
NG >> [Air mix door motor (passenger side) does not operate normally.]
Replace air mix door motor (passenger side).
